1. What are Invisible Air Dancers?

Invisible Air Dancers are a modern take on traditional inflatable advertising. They generally have a more streamlined and less cartoonish appearance, often featuring a transparent design that allows them to blend into their surroundings while still capturing attention. They are often used in events, storefronts, and other promotional activities.

2. What are Traditional Inflatable Advertisements?

Traditional inflatable advertising typically includes eye-catching characters, shapes, or signs that are designed to stand out. These can be anything from giant balloon animals to large inflatable signs. Their bright colors and bold designs are aimed at drawing in customers from a distance.

3. What are the Pros and Cons of Each?

Here are some points to consider when comparing Invisible Air Dancers and traditional inflatables:

  1. Eye-catching Designs: Traditional inflatables tend to have brighter colors and more whimsical designs that are designed to attract attention. However, Invisible Air Dancers can attract attention through movement, making them visually engaging without being overly flashy.
  2. Customization: Both types of inflatable advertising can be customized. However, traditional inflatables offer more freedom in terms of shapes and characters, while Invisible Air Dancers can be designed with branding elements that are less noticeable but equally effective.
  3. Portability: Traditional inflatables can be bulky to transport and set up, whereas Invisible Air Dancers are generally lighter and easier to handle.
  4. Weather Resistance: While both types are susceptible to high winds, traditional inflatables often fare better against harsh weather conditions due to their weight and stability.

4. Where Can They Be Used?

Both Inflatable Air Dancers and traditional models can be used in a variety of settings, including:

  1. Retail Stores: They can attract customers into stores, especially during sales or promotions.
  2. Events and Festivals: Both types of inflatable advertising work well in crowded environments where it is essential to draw attention.
  3. Grand Openings: Using an eye-catching inflatable can help create a buzz around a new business.

5. Which One Should You Choose?

Choosing between Invisible Air Dancers and traditional inflatable advertising largely depends on your goals and target audience. If you're looking for a fun, whimsical approach that stands out, traditional inflatables might work best for you. On the other hand, if you prefer a more subtle but effective advertisement, consider going with an Inflatable Air Dancer. The movement it brings can add an engaging element that draws people in without being overly loud.
